Char Siu Chicken

Irresistible Char Siu Chicken: Sweet Asian BBQ Bliss

Char Siu Chicken is a mouthwatering dish that brings vibrant flavors of Chinese BBQ to your home.
Prep Time 30 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Marinating Time 2 hours
Total Time 3 hours
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: Chinese
Calories: 350

Ingredients
  

For the Marinade
  • 1/3 cup Hoisin sauce
  • 1/4 cup Soy sauce Low-sodium recommended
  • 2 tablespoons Honey
  • 2 tablespoons Oyster sauce Substitute with mushroom sauce for vegetarian
  • 2 tablespoons Rice vinegar Apple cider vinegar is a substitute
  • 4 cloves Garlic, minced Fresh garlic is recommended
  • 1 teaspoon Chinese five-spice powder
  • 1 tablespoon Sesame oil Omit for a lighter version
For the Chicken
  • 1 pound Boneless, skinless chicken thighs Chicken breasts can work but may need different cooking times

Equipment

  • Oven
  • mixing bowl
  • Baking Sheet
  • Resealable Plastic Bag
  • saucepan

Method
 

Step‑by‑Step Instructions for Char Siu Chicken
  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a medium bowl, combine hoisin sauce, soy sauce, honey, oyster sauce, rice vinegar, minced garlic, Chinese five-spice powder, and sesame oil. Whisk until smooth and well blended.
  3. Place chicken thighs in a resealable plastic bag, pour half the marinade over, seal, massage to coat, and refrigerate for at least 2 hours or overnight.
  4. Set aside the remaining marinade in the refrigerator for later use.
  5. Remove marinated chicken from fridge and let sit at room temperature for about 30 minutes.
  6.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per, arrange marinated chicken thighs in a single layer.
  7. Bake the chicken for 25-30 minutes until fully cooked through at 165°F (75°C).
  8. While baking, boil the reserved marinade in a saucepan over medium heat for about 10 minutes to thicken.
  9. After baking, brush chicken with thickened marinade and broil for 2-3 minutes until glazed.
  10. Allow to rest for a few minutes before slicing and serve with your favorite sides.

Notes

For best results, marinate overnight. Always check the internal temperature to ensure it's safe and juicy.
